物聯網作為新一代信息技術的高度集成與綜合應用,其發展離不開底層關鍵技術的強力支撐。在數據采集、傳輸與處理的閉環中,數據庫、搜索引擎與技術服務構成了物聯網系統的三大核心引擎,共同驅動著物理世界與數字世界的深度融合與智能演進。
物聯網數據庫是處理來自傳感器、設備、系統等產生的海量、高速、多樣化數據的核心。與傳統的數據庫相比,物聯網數據庫面臨著獨特的挑戰與要求。
1. 技術特點與要求:
高吞吐與低延遲: 需要實時或近實時地接收和處理億萬級設備產生的時序數據流。
靈活的數據模型: 需支持結構化、半結構化(如JSON)和非結構化數據,適應設備類型的多樣性和數據格式的復雜性。
強大的時空數據處理能力: 物聯網數據天然帶有時間和空間標簽,數據庫需要高效支持時空查詢與分析。
邊緣與云協同: 為降低延遲和帶寬消耗,需要在網絡邊緣進行數據預處理和輕量存儲,并與云端中心數據庫協同。
2. 主流技術選擇: 時序數據庫(如InfluxDB、TimescaleDB)因其對時間序列數據的高效壓縮和檢索能力成為首選;NoSQL數據庫(如MongoDB、Cassandra)以其靈活的模式和水平擴展性處理半結構化數據;而新興的時空數據庫和時序-關系混合型數據庫也在特定場景中展現優勢。
當數據被有效存儲后,如何快速、精準地從中提取有價值的信息成為關鍵。物聯網搜索引擎正是為此而生,它超越了傳統互聯網搜索引擎的范疇。
1. 核心功能與挑戰:
設備與數據發現: 能夠快速索引和搜索網絡中數以億計的物聯網設備及其狀態、屬性、歷史數據。
復雜事件處理: 支持對連續數據流進行模式匹配和復雜條件查詢,例如發現“某區域溫度連續5分鐘超過閾值且濕度驟降”的事件。
語義搜索與關聯分析: 理解數據的上下文和語義,不僅能搜索數據值,還能發現設備間、數據間的關聯關系。
實時性: 搜索結果的延遲必須極低,以支持監控、告警等實時應用。
2. 技術實現: 通常基于分布式索引技術(如Elasticsearch、Apache Solr),并結合流處理引擎(如Apache Flink、Spark Streaming)實現實時索引更新與復雜事件查詢。知識圖譜技術的引入,則能更好地構建設備、數據、事件之間的語義網絡,提升搜索的智能水平。
數據庫和搜索引擎提供了強大的“武器”,而物聯網技術服務則是將這些武器交付給開發者與最終用戶,并確保整個系統可靠、安全、高效運行的“作戰體系”。
1. 服務體系構成:
設備管理服務: 提供設備的全生命周期管理,包括注冊、認證、配置、監控、固件升級等。
連接與網絡服務: 保障設備到云、設備到設備之間穩定、安全、高效的通信,支持多種網絡協議(如MQTT, CoAP, LwM2M)并處理網絡異構性。
數據分析與智能服務: 在基礎數據之上,提供數據可視化、機器學習模型訓練與部署、預測性維護、數字孿生等增值服務。
安全服務: 貫穿始終,包括設備身份認證、數據傳輸加密、訪問控制、安全審計等,構筑端到端的安全防線。
* 平臺即服務/后端即服務: 提供豐富的API、SDK和開發工具,降低應用開發門檻,讓開發者聚焦業務邏輯。
2. 部署模式: 從公有云物聯網平臺(如AWS IoT, Azure IoT, 阿里云物聯網平臺)提供的全托管服務,到私有化部署的解決方案,技術服務正朝著模塊化、微服務化的方向發展,以滿足不同規模、不同行業客戶的定制化需求。
物聯網數據庫、搜索引擎和技術服務并非孤立存在,而是緊密耦合、協同工作的有機整體。高性能的數據庫為搜索引擎提供了高質量的數據源;智能的搜索引擎使得沉淀在數據庫中的“數據石油”得以提煉和利用;而綜合、易用的技術服務則將前兩者的能力封裝、輸出,最終賦能于智慧城市、工業互聯網、智能家居、車聯網等千行百業的具體應用。
隨著邊緣計算的普及、人工智能的深化以及5G/6G網絡的演進,這三大技術引擎將進一步融合:數據庫將更加智能化,具備原生AI分析能力;搜索引擎將更實時、更語境感知;技術服務將更自動化、更無感化。三者共同進化的目標,是讓物聯網系統真正成為具備自主感知、智能決策和協同執行能力的“神經系統”,無縫連接萬物,深度賦能世界。
如若轉載,請注明出處:http://www.vzto.cn/product/11.html
更新時間:2026-05-29 17:28:52